From what I have observed, CIC works via a batch processing model. The officer reviews your file. Something is missing, they ask you for it. Your file now goes back into the queue. The next time the officer reviews it, if something is missing, they ask. From what I can tell, they do not create a comprehensive list of anything that is missing and the time between reviews is 2-4 months.

1. Your wife can travel on visitor visa to canada, remember to apply for it once your sponsorship is approved. To get a visitor visa for a spouse is rather difficult as CIC hardly approves it. But some of them have got it, and there is no harm in doing so.

2. As you would be applying through New Delhi, the official timeline is 15 months + the sponsorship approval time (approx. 55 days). But most of the applications are cleared in 8 months from the date of application, if the case is straight forward.

3. You should go through the CIC website for all the forms and additional documents required, you should read the document guideline available. If any further query, than you may ask in the forum, people are always here to help.

4. Should collect your communication details, skype, viber, call details, photographs of your meetings. You may start sending emails to each other, so that you can add that to your application.

Hopefully this helps. You may follow New Delhi 2014 thread for more information specific to Indian applications and timelines.
